The history of Disciples III is a story of redemption. The initial release, Disciples III: Renaissance , was plagued by significant bugs, unbalanced mechanics, and design choices that alienated fans of the classic, grid-based tactical gameplay of Disciples II . Reincarnation is the response to these criticisms, a comprehensive overhaul that merges Renaissance with its expansion Resurrection into a single, coherent, and vastly improved experience.
